Young man seriously injured after Beeston attack as police appeal for witnesses

A man has been seriously injured after being attacked in Beeston, police said.

Detectives are appealing for witnesses after the assault in Leeds.

The attack happened at around 8.50pm on Saturday May 29 on Dewsbury Road, close to the junction of Temple Road.

Officers attended and found a man who was seriously injured, police said.

The 24-year-old was taken to hospital and his injuries are not believed to be life threatening, police confirmed.

Enquiries are ongoing and officers are appealing to members of the public to assist.

Anyone who may have been present at the time of the incident or may have dash cam footage that will assist with enquiries is asked to contact 101 and quoting reference 13210267759.

Alternatively, independent charity Crimestoppers can be contacted on 0800 555 111.
